Britain has warned of an increasing threat from Russia, as a Russian spy ship passed by the English coast for the second time in three months, testing British military capabilities. The Yantar, a Russian spy vessel known for intelligence gathering, was monitored by two Royal Navy ships for two days. Concerns about Russian activity around underwater cables connecting Britain to Europe have prompted NATO to deploy warships in the Baltic Sea to protect critical infrastructure.

The EU doesn’t need a deal with Trump
Ursula von der Leyen is meeting Donald Trump in Scotland to discuss trade as tariff deadlines approach, drawing insights from her recent summits with Japan and China. The article argues that the EU should not concede to US pressures, highlighting the unpredictable nature of Trump's negotiations and suggesting that both the US and EU have more to lose than appears.
